The very first batch of lc I mixed up using 1 tablespoon each of light malt extract and dextrose came out of the pc with extreme amounts of sediments I noc'd it up anyway but didn't have any luck. The second round I weighed 2grams of lme with 1/2 a gram of dextrose and it worked perfect, it was almost clear with no sediments and was ready to use within a week.
